Business Operations Manager Visa Sponsorship Jobs in Nevada
Nevada's business operations manager roles are concentrated in Las Vegas's hospitality and gaming sector, with major employers like MGM Resorts, Caesars Entertainment, and Wynn Resorts regularly hiring at the operations management level. Reno's growing tech and logistics corridor adds further opportunity. International candidates typically pursue H-1B visa or E-3 visa sponsorship for these specialty occupation positions.

Which companies sponsor visas for business operations managers in Nevada?
Las Vegas-based hospitality giants including MGM Resorts International, Caesars Entertainment, and Wynn Resorts have histories of sponsoring H-1B visas for management roles. Beyond gaming, Switch (data centers) and Amazon's regional fulfillment operations in the Reno area have also filed LCAs for operations management positions. Sponsorship is not guaranteed and varies by employer, role scope, and whether the position meets specialty occupation requirements.
Which visa types are most common for business operations manager roles in Nevada?
The H-1B is the most common visa for business operations manager roles, provided the position requires at least a bachelor's degree in a specific field such as business administration, operations management, or a related discipline. Australian citizens may pursue the E-3 visa, which follows a similar specialty occupation standard but without the lottery. L-1A intracompany transfers are also relevant for managers relocating from a foreign affiliate to a Nevada office.
Which cities in Nevada have the most business operations manager sponsorship jobs?
Las Vegas accounts for the majority of business operations manager sponsorship activity in Nevada, driven by its concentrated hospitality, gaming, and convention industry. Reno is the second-largest market, with growing demand from logistics, warehousing, and technology companies expanding along the Interstate 80 corridor. Henderson and North Las Vegas see some activity tied to healthcare systems and light manufacturing, though at significantly lower volume than the Las Vegas metro.

What should international candidates know about business operations manager roles in Nevada?
Nevada has no state income tax, which affects prevailing wage comparisons since take-home pay differs from states with income tax, though DOL prevailing wage determinations are set at the federal level by metro area regardless. The Las Vegas hospitality sector operates on irregular schedules and high-volume environments, which is relevant context when evaluating role fit. Because Nevada's economy is heavily concentrated in gaming and tourism, operations manager roles often require industry-specific experience that can strengthen or limit a candidacy depending on your background.
What is the prevailing wage for sponsored business operations manager jobs in Nevada?
U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
